Time Lapse of Antron Brown’s New-Look Mello Yellow Wrap

As part of the biggest race of the year on the series, the NHRA announced that it has reached an agreement with Mello Yello to extend the drink’s run as the series sponsor. To celebrate the extension of the sixteen year relationship and the drink’s future with the sport, three-time Top Fuel series world champion Antron Brown unveiled a new wrap bearing the brand’s familiar yellow hue to accompany Brown’s Matco Tools/US Army/Toyota livery.

“I’m real excited to have Mello Yello join Matco Tools, the U.S. Army, and Toyota on our racecar for the U.S. Nationals,” and excited Brown said at the car’s unveiling. “Mello Yello is the fuel that has driven our sport to the level it’s at today. It’s a real honor to be asked to represent Mello Yello like this at our biggest race of the year.”

Antron brought the car, which had been kept under a cover in his pit throughout the day, to staging for the unveiling of the new design just before Friday’s opening qualifying session. He followed the reveal with a great 3.689 elapsed time that qualifies him in third place after the first day of competition. “With as tough as the competition is now in Top Fuel, having Mello Yello on our car can only give us a little extra boost in the tank so we can really Go On Yellow at The Big Go” added Antron.

Below, a short video shows Don Schumacher Racing’s in-house graphics man applying the new wrap to Antron’s car last week at DSR’s headquarters in nearby Brownsburg, IN. The graphics are all applied in sections to make them a little easier for one guy to handle. The vinyl goes on in layers, with the sponsor logos being the final step. If you ever wanted to know how these cars get their look, and how the can change them so easily from race to race, this video tells a lot of that story.
